The Great Atlantic Pivot: How the West is Rewriting Global Financial Rules for Itself
The post-2008 global regulatory framework, particularly Basel III, is undergoing a significant reassessment by Western powers like the US, UK, and EU, who are prioritizing domestic growth and competitiveness through a process they call 'modernization'. This self-serving pivot by the Atlantic powers exposes the hypocrisy of an 'international rules-based order' they championed, now being unilaterally rewritten to benefit their own financial systems while the Global South is expected to remain compliant with standards designed to constrain our development.
